Having worn Merrell shoes for years, my expectations were high. I really wanted to like the Moab 2.
These are comfortable right out-of-the-box, and, for me, their foot support is excellent. After about 100 miles, they seem adequately sturdy and reasonably well-made.
One downside is that the fabric lace-holds and single top-eyelet limit lacing options.
But the main problem is that traction is entirely unreliable on wet surfaces, particularly on rocky trails, stone slabs, and other, similar ones. This ranges from tricky, watch-your-step situations to no-way-they're-going-to-hold-so-go-around ones.
I was testing these for PCT use in 2020. Regrettably, I conclude that I must look elsewhere.

I hike a lot in the NM mountains and foothills. The shoes have good grip on the slick rocks & loose gravel, which makes me very happy. No issues with the cushion of the shoe. I find them quite comfortable and have worn them on daily hikes of up to 10 or 11 miles with no discomfort.
The shoes do fit a bit larger than expected so I wear thicker socks, which also corrected the sore toes I was getting at first. At that time I contacted Merrell and they offered to replace the shoes. But I couldn't see doing that as the socks fixed it. I am very happy with the shoes so much so that I bought a 2nd pair.
However, the reason I cannot give a higher rating is because after several months the shoes are wearing out! They, both shoes, have holes in the fabric covered cushion around the top. The right shoe also has a hole inside at the back of the heel & something blue is coming out from under the footbed. I am disappointed that they are not holding up better to my daily hikes.

I had an old pair of Moabs that finally wore out. So I figured I would move to the moab 2. Big mistake. These are so uncomfortable. The left shoe feels like there is a metal rod in the shoe that is loose and vibrating with every step. Literally, I can bounce my feet on the floor and it gives me an odd sensation. The insole is terrible. There is very little padding at the toe and I find with the odd vibration and no padding, the ball of my foot gets uncomfortable. I've had them for about 2 months and have just been trying to break them in - walking to the park... I would not trust hiking in them. I have a 23 mile backpacking trip coming up and I had hoped to use them for that trip. But I don't trust them at all to be comfortable. I replaced the insole and that has helped. but the left foot is still bad and my foot starts to feel numb after 2 miles. My wife also had moabs and moved to the moab 2 and is experiencing blisters at the base of her heel as the insole is too big and has developed a "fold" where it runs vertical up the shoe. I used to recommend Merrells, however after this experience, I can no longer.
